After doing a 6 month long study into AEO and SEO results, I recently shared these findings with live audiences at Google Summit 2025 and First Page Digital Summit 2025. In particular, i was interested in Brands that were consistently ranking first on Google were not being recommended by AI, while other brands that barely appeared on page one were showing up confidently in ChatGPT and Google AI Overviews.

At first, this felt like noise. However, once the same mismatches repeated across industries, prompts, and clients, it became clear that discovery itself was fragmenting. Google Search was no longer the only system deciding visibility.

This article documents what we studied across Google Search, Google AI Overviews, and ChatGPT, how we measured agreement and disagreement, and why the idea of a single AEO strategy breaks down the moment you look closely.

What We Studied and Why Granularity Matters

  • 44 commercial topics
  • 560 unique websites
  • 20 industry niches
  • 4 business types
  • Google Search results
  • Google AI Overviews (AIO)
  • ChatGPT answers and citations
  • E-commerce and B2B ecommerce
  • Services and home services
  • Location-based businesses
  • YMYL sectors such as law and preschool

We deliberately designed the study to span multiple industries and prompt types. Early testing showed that high-level averages hide more than they reveal. Once we segmented by niche, business model, and platform, behaviours that initially looked inconsistent started to form clear patterns.

Granularity was not a methodological detail. It was the difference between insight and confusion.

How We Measured Agreement and Divergence

  • Jaccard similarity
  • Spearman rank correlation
  • Top-1 recommendation agreement

Before interpreting outcomes, it was important to define how similarity and disagreement were measured. No single metric captures how recommendation systems behave, so we used multiple measures to reflect different dimensions of agreement.

Jaccard Similarity: Do the Same Brands Even Appear?

  • Overall AI-to-AI overlap: ~0.206
  • B2C ecommerce: ~0.206
  • B2B ecommerce: ~0.356
  • Services: ~0.285
  • YMYL: ~0.101

Jaccard similarity measures whether the same brands appear at all, regardless of order. The low values across most segments showed that ChatGPT and Google AIO often do not even evaluate the same pool of brands. This is especially pronounced in YMYL niches, where overlap is close to zero, indicating that each system relies on different authority ecosystems.

Spearman Rank Correlation: When Brands Overlap, Do They Rank Similarly?

  • Overall rank correlation: ~0.26

Spearman correlation measures whether platforms rank overlapping brands in a similar order. The low correlation indicates that even when systems agree on which brands matter, they often disagree on how strongly they matter.

Top-1 Agreement: Who Actually Wins?

  • ChatGPT #1 = Google #1: ~20–25%
  • Google AIO #1 = Google #1: ~8–11%
  • ChatGPT #1 = AIO #1: 18%

Top-1 agreement reflects real-world impact. Users tend to remember the first recommendation, and the consistently low agreement rates confirm that being the best is now platform-specific.

What Our Study Found: Where AI and Google Actually Align

  • Average AI #1 = Google #1: ~15.6–18%
  • ChatGPT #1 = Google #1: ~20–25% depending on segment
  • Google AIO #1 = Google #1: ~8–11%
  • ChatGPT and AIO agree on #1 brand: 18% of topics
  • Overall rank alignment (Spearman): ~0.26

At a surface level, these numbers suggest weak alignment, but the more important takeaway is that disagreement is the default state rather than an edge case. In most scenarios, Google Search, Google AI Overviews, and ChatGPT surfaced different brands as their primary recommendation, even when evaluating the same prompt.

This tells us that rankings alone are no longer a reliable proxy for visibility. AI systems are not ranking pages in the traditional sense. They are selecting answers based on defensibility, pattern repetition, and evidence availability, which produces fundamentally different outcomes.

Services vs E-commerce: Two Different Systems of Trust

  • Cross-inclusion for services: ~31–32%
  • Cross-inclusion for e-commerce: ~17–18%
  • Higher ChatGPT–AIO agreement in services than e-commerce

When segmented by business model, the divergence became much clearer. Services categories showed higher overlap between AI platforms, suggesting shared logic around reputation, experience, and proof. E-commerce categories, however, showed much weaker overlap and frequent reversals, where brands recommended by AI were not the ones ranking well on Google.

This difference reflects how trust is evaluated. Services rely on outcomes, credibility, and perceived expertise, while e-commerce relies on comparison, validation, and third-party judgement. AI mirrors these trust models closely, which is why applying the same optimisation strategy across both models consistently underperforms.

What Our Study Found: Citations Did Not Depend On Rankings

  • Consumer electronics listicle citation rate: 68–72%
  • Home services listicle reliance (ChatGPT): ~67%
  • Home services brand page reliance (AIO): ~67%
  • Videography commercial page citations: AIO 84.4%, ChatGPT 73.8%
  • Social and GBP citations in lifestyle (AIO): ~23%

Once we shifted focus from answers to citations, platform behaviour became much easier to explain. Google AIO tended to rely more on brand-owned commercial pages and traditional Google-style signals, while ChatGPT leaned more heavily on editorial content, listicles, and aggregators, particularly in services and lifestyle niches.

Even within the same business model, citation behaviour changed by industry. This is why citation targeting must be segmented not only by platform, but also by niche and prompt type. Without this segmentation, brands often invest heavily in sources that the AI platform does not meaningfully value.

High-Trust (YMYL) Niches: Authority as a Gatekeeper

  • Law authority citations: AIO 33.3%, ChatGPT 25.0%
  • Preschool authority citations: AIO 13.6%, ChatGPT 25.0%
  • Dominant sources: government directories, regulators, ranking platforms

YMYL niches behaved differently from almost every other category. In these sectors, authority listings acted as gatekeepers rather than enhancers. If a brand or firm was not present in recognised directories or official registries, AI visibility was inconsistent regardless of content quality.

This reframes AEO in YMYL categories as an ecosystem participation problem rather than a traditional optimisation problem. Content supports authority, but it rarely substitutes for it.

Why AI Rewards the “Average” Brand

  • Next-word prediction as the core decision engine
  • Concept proximity over qualitative judgment
  • Preference for statistically safe, repeatable answers

When people hear that AI uses next-word prediction, it often sounds abstract and disconnected from real-world outcomes. However, this mechanism directly explains why certain brands are repeatedly recommended while others are consistently ignored.

AI does not evaluate brands the way a human reviewer would. It does not assess originality, innovation, or differentiation in a qualitative sense. Instead, it predicts which sequence of words is most likely to appear next based on everything it has seen before, and for recommendation prompts this means selecting brands that most commonly appear alongside a topic with familiar attributes in trusted contexts.

This is where concept proximity becomes critical. Brands that sit closest to the centre of a topic’s conceptual space are easier for AI to predict because they use familiar language, repeat widely accepted attributes, and appear consistently across multiple sources, which reduces uncertainty.

By contrast, brands that differentiate aggressively often fragment their signals. Unique positioning, novel terminology, or niche claims may convert users, but if they appear inconsistently or only in brand-controlled content, they introduce risk that AI systems avoid.

This is why AI tends to reward what looks like the average option. Average does not mean mediocre. It means statistically central and defensible, supported by overlapping evidence that makes the recommendation easy to justify.

The Supernode Effect and Why Distribution Wins

  • Large editorial and lifestyle publications
  • Aggregator and “best of” listicles
  • Competitor-written roundups and rankings
  • Authority and institutional directories

As we analysed citations across prompts and industries, a relatively small group of websites kept appearing repeatedly in AI answers. These sites were not always the strongest in a traditional SEO sense, but they were consistently referenced across many different contexts.

We started referring to these sites as supernodes.

Supernodes act as stable reference hubs for AI systems. Because they appear frequently across different prompts, they become statistically reliable sources that AI can reuse to justify recommendations with low risk.

Supernode websites observed in the study

  • TechRadar
  • RTINGS
  • Legal500
  • Chambers
  • Government and regulatory directories
  • Straits Times
  • Third-party and competitor “best of” roundups

What makes supernodes powerful is repetition rather than authority in isolation. Each additional appearance increases conceptual certainty, making brands easier to recommend again in future answers.

This explains why some brands consistently outperform their apparent authority. Their advantage lies in distribution across trusted hubs rather than superior on-site optimisation, which is why distribution eventually beats optimisation once baseline quality is met.

Industry and Platform Playbooks

Playbook: E-commerce

  • AI rewards expert and niche listicles
  • Retailer and category page presence matters
  • Attribute parity with reviewed competitors is critical

For e-commerce, success comes from aligning product pages with the attributes AI repeatedly sees in expert reviews, while simultaneously securing placements on authoritative listicles that AI uses as evidence. Rankings alone are insufficient without third-party validation.

Playbook: Services

  • AI rewards proof of outcomes and experience
  • Commercial pages matter more than blogs
  • Third-party validation varies by niche

For services, strong commercial pages with portfolios, case studies, and client proof form the foundation, but off-site validation must be selectively layered based on how each platform evaluates the specific service category.

Playbook: Home Services

  • ChatGPT favours third-party and competitor listicles
  • Google AIO favours brand-owned commercial pages

Home services require a balanced strategy. Over-investing in one platform’s signals creates blind spots on the other. Brands that perform best reinforce both listicle presence and on-site proof.

Playbook: YMYL Niches

  • Authority listings are non-negotiable
  • Official registries and rankings dominate citations

In YMYL categories, the first priority is securing authority placements. Content optimisation supports these signals but rarely compensates for missing institutional validation.

Playbook: AEO Analysis by Prompt

  • Extract entities from AI answers
  • Identify overlapping entities in citations
  • Segment by platform and industry
  • Replicate entities across trusted sources
  • Track AI visibility rather than rankings

This prompt-level approach reflects how AI systems actually reason and avoids the false comfort of generic optimisation tactics.

Final Notes From the Field

SEO still matters, but it no longer explains discovery on its own. AI systems reward consistency, distribution, and contextual fit, and they do so differently depending on industry, platform, and prompt type.

There is no one-size-fits-all AEO approach. The brands that win stop asking how to optimise for AI in general and start asking how AI reasons about their specific market, which is where predictable outcomes begin.
